The Role Of TLR9 And 1,25(OH)2D3 On The Pathogenesis Of Systemic Lupus Erythematosus

Objective:1.The study is to investigate the signal pathway of Toll-like receptor signal(TLR-9)in B lymphocyte stimulating factor(BLyS)induced systemic lupus erythematosus(SLE)transgenic mice model,detect anti-dsDNA antibody titer,C3 and C4 complement levels,inflammation index IL-10 and disease activity ESR,CRP level.2.We detect the expression of TLR9 mRNA in SLE patients and the serum level of IL-10 and illuminate the association between these indexes and the activity of SLE.3.We also discuss the modulation of 1,25(OH)2D3 on SLE patients.All of the three parts are in order to provide basis for the pathogenesis and new therapeutic targets of SLE.Methods:1.The transgenic female mice of EB virus membrane antigen BLLFl were composed by 21 animals,with age of 8-10-week old and weighting 30-40g.The mice were randomly divided into blank control group,BLyS blocker group and TLR-9 blocker group,which formed by 7 animals each,while the blank control group was received intraperitoneal injection of equal amount of normal saline;Anti-BR3 monoclonal antibody 500μg/d/time was applied in BLyS blocker group,with continuous intraperitoneal injection for 10d;Anti-human TLR-9 antibody 250ng/d/time was adopted in TLR-9 blocker group,with continuous intraperitoneal injection for 10d.Peripheral venous blood should be taken after keep feeding for 10d.The relative expression of TLR-9 mRNA was tested by RT-PCR;BLyS protein concentration and IL-10 level were detected by ELISA.2.We collected 106 SLE patients to detect some clinical indexes.The relative expression of TLR-9 nRNA was tested by RT-PCR;BLyS protein concentration and IL-10 level were detected by ELISA.The immunization spots method is for detection of anti dsDNA,and conventional biochemical method is for detecting C3,C4 and ESR and CRP level.3.The study was carried out on patients with SLE,diagnosed according to American College of Rheumatology(ACR)revised classification criteria.18 SLE patients with clinical suspicion of were collected.The concentration of 25(OH)D of these patients and the expression of TLR 9 by immunohistochemistry.Results:1.The difference in comparison of TLR-9 mRNA of three groups before intervention has no statistical significance(P>0.05);there was no obvious change in control group after intervention,while the TLR-9 mRNA of BLyS blocker group and TLR-9 blocker group have decreased distinctly,and TLR-9 mRNA of TLR-9 blocker group was lower than that of BLyS blocker group,with statistical significance(P<0.05).The difference in comparison of BLyS protein concentration and IL-10 level of three groups before intervention has no statistical significance(P>0,05);there was no obvious change in control group after intervention,while BLyS protein concentration and IL-10 level of BLyS blocker group and TLR-9 blocker group have decreased distinctly,with statistical significance(P<0.05);but the difference in comparison between BLyS blocker group and TLR-9 blocker group has no statistical significance(P>0.05).The difference in comparison of anti-dsDNA antibody titer and C3,C4,ESR,CRP level of three groups before intervention has no statistical significance(P>0.05);there was no obvious change in control group after intervention,while above indexes of BLyS blocker group and TLR-9 blocker group have decreased distinctly,with statistical significance(P<0.05);but the difference in comparison between BLyS blocker group and TLR-9 blocker group has no statistical significance(P>0.05).2.Compared with SLE patients in stable condition,the ones with active situation,the expression of TLR9 mRNA,IL-10 was significantly higher(P<0.01),while 25(OH)D levels decreased significantly(P<0.01).3.LN sections showed a high amount of TLR9 expression.We found a positive correlation between TLR9 and disease activity.We detected a negative correlation between glomerular TLR9 and the concentration of 25(OH)D(r=-0.764/P<0.01),as well as tubular TLR9(r=-0.741 p<0.01).We also detected a positive correlation between tubular TLR9 expression and SLEDAI-INDEX(r=0.61 p=0.008),as well as tubular TLR9(r=0.61 p=0.007).Conclusion:1.It implied that TLR-9 may be an important signaling pathway of BLyS induced SLE,regulating inflammatory immune level,so taking intervention for TLR-9 or BLyS expression can inhibit autoimmune injury process of SLE.2.The increased expression of TLR9 mRNA and IL-10 implied the increased activity of the disease.3.1,25(OH)2 D3 may dcrease the expression of TLR9 and play a role in the treatment of SLE.
